Difference between the MOSFET and BJT

In MOSFET, the current flow is either due to the electrons (n-channel MOS) or due to the holes (p-channel MOS).

In BJT, we see the current flow due to both the carriers: electrons and holes. The BJT is a current controlled device and MOSFET is a voltage controlled device.

